Obie Benz is a social activist and heir to a baking empire. Among the socially conscious organizations he was part of was the MUSE Foundation through which he produced the No Nukes documentary. He later became a writer and director. In 1981, he directed Americas in Transition a documentary short that chronicled U.S. involvement in Latin America. He did not make his feature-film debut until seven years later with Heavy Petting, a satirical psuedo-documentary that examined the sexual mores of the 1950s.
